In the market for a new motorcycle and want to check it out in a showroom? Here is our list of all authorised dealers in India. Pick your preferred option and go through the contact details.The most popular OEM currently in India is Royal Enfield, has one of the widest dealer networks of about 999 dealerships and sells 14 models. Other popular OEM's current include TVS, Bajaj, Hero, Honda, Suzuki.
